Oil pulling is pretty simple.  All you need is some sort of unrefined oil and about 15-20 minutes a day.  I usually use coconut oil, but you can use sesame or sunflower as well.... most others are too thick.

First thing in the morning I take about a tablespoon of oil put it in my mouth and swish it around for about 15-20 minutes.  The oil causes you to produce saliva..lots of saliva.. which helps to break down tarter and plauque.  It also get in between teeth and under the gum line better than flossing can.  The mixture of the oil and saliva breaks up the hard stuff that collects on teeth and gums causing problems.  I noticed a huge difference in the appearance and feel of my teeth after the first time.  People are always asking me if I have had my teeth whitened.
